黑狐家游戏

哪些技术属于大数据的关键技术多选题,哪些技术属于大数据的关键技术

欧气 3 0

《解析大数据关键技术:构建数据驱动的未来》

一、大数据关键技术概述

哪些技术属于大数据的关键技术多选题,哪些技术属于大数据的关键技术

图片来源于网络,如有侵权联系删除

在当今数字化时代,大数据已经成为企业和组织获取竞争优势的重要资产,大数据的关键技术涵盖了从数据采集、存储到分析处理等多个环节,这些技术相互协作,共同挖掘数据中的价值。

二、数据采集技术

1、传感器技术

- 传感器广泛应用于各个领域,如工业生产中的温度、压力传感器,环境监测中的空气质量、水质传感器等,在智能城市建设中,交通传感器可以实时采集道路上车辆的流量、速度等信息,这些传感器不断产生海量的原始数据,是大数据的重要来源,在工业4.0的场景下,生产设备上的传感器可以每秒采集数百个数据点,如设备的运行温度、振动频率等,为预测性维护提供数据基础。

- 传感器技术的发展趋势是朝着高精度、微型化和智能化方向发展,智能传感器不仅能够采集数据,还能对数据进行初步处理,减少数据传输过程中的冗余。

2、网络爬虫技术

- 网络爬虫主要用于从互联网上采集公开的数据,搜索引擎利用爬虫遍历网页,获取网页的文本、链接等信息,对于电商平台来说,爬虫可以采集商品价格、用户评价等数据,网络爬虫需要遵循相关的法律法规和网站的规则,以避免侵犯他人权益,在数据采集过程中,爬虫需要处理反爬虫机制,如验证码识别、IP封锁等挑战,爬虫技术也在不断进化,从简单的单线程爬虫发展到分布式爬虫,以提高数据采集的效率。

哪些技术属于大数据的关键技术多选题,哪些技术属于大数据的关键技术

图片来源于网络,如有侵权联系删除

三、数据存储技术

1、分布式文件系统(DFS)

- 以Hadoop分布式文件系统(HDFS)为例,它是为了能够在普通硬件上存储海量数据而设计的,HDFS采用了主从架构,一个NameNode管理文件系统的元数据,多个DataNode存储实际的数据块,这种架构使得数据能够分布存储在多个节点上,提高了存储的可靠性和可扩展性,当数据量不断增长时,可以方便地添加新的DataNode来扩展存储容量,在大型互联网公司,每天产生的用户日志数据可以通过HDFS进行存储,这些数据可以达到PB级别的规模。

2、NoSQL数据库

- NoSQL数据库摒弃了传统关系数据库的一些限制,更适合处理大数据中的非结构化和半结构化数据,MongoDB是一种流行的文档型NoSQL数据库,它以灵活的文档格式存储数据,适合存储如用户评论、社交网络中的动态等数据,Cassandra是一种分布式的列存储数据库,具有高可用性和可扩展性,适用于大规模的写入密集型应用,如实时监控数据的存储,NoSQL数据库的出现满足了大数据应用对存储和处理速度的要求。

四、数据处理与分析技术

1、MapReduce编程模型

哪些技术属于大数据的关键技术多选题,哪些技术属于大数据的关键技术

图片来源于网络,如有侵权联系删除

- MapReduce是一种用于大规模数据集(大于1TB)并行运算的编程模型,它将数据处理任务分解为Map(映射)和Reduce(归约)两个阶段,在Map阶段,数据被并行处理,例如对海量文本数据中的单词进行计数时,Map函数会将每个文档中的单词提取并标记,在Reduce阶段,对Map阶段的结果进行汇总,如将相同单词的计数进行累加,MapReduce的优势在于它可以自动处理并行计算中的任务调度、数据分配和容错等问题,使得开发人员能够专注于数据处理逻辑。

2、机器学习技术

- 机器学习是大数据分析的核心技术之一,在大数据环境下,有监督学习算法如线性回归、决策树等可用于预测分析,例如根据用户的历史消费行为预测其未来的购买倾向,无监督学习算法如聚类分析可用于对用户进行细分,将具有相似行为的用户归为一类,深度学习作为机器学习的一个分支,在图像识别、语音识别等领域取得了巨大的成功,在医疗影像分析中,深度学习模型可以通过分析大量的X光、CT等影像数据,辅助医生进行疾病诊断。

3、数据可视化技术

- 数据可视化技术可以将复杂的数据以直观的图形、图表等形式展示出来,在商业智能领域,通过柱状图、折线图等展示销售数据的趋势和分布,对于地理空间数据,使用地图可视化可以直观地呈现数据的地理分布特征,有效的数据可视化能够帮助决策者快速理解数据中的关键信息,从而做出更明智的决策。

传感器技术、网络爬虫技术、分布式文件系统、NoSQL数据库、MapReduce编程模型、机器学习技术和数据可视化技术等都属于大数据的关键技术,它们在大数据的整个生命周期中发挥着不可或缺的作用。

标签: #大数据存储 #数据挖掘 #数据采集 #数据可视化

黑狐家游戏
  • 评论列表

留言评论